Transaction 5872ef6266578c49ea4a2019e70e97d045068c9ad16eb3896259fb68a53383c8

block
ad33afcd469b0d428c86bf308269b6e75be42c68f612d1c735b9fa518a4beaa5

4 Inputs

15 Outputs